A flexible modular data-acquisition system was designed and built. A general purpose DAM based on the ADuC848 microcontroller was designed for monitoring biometeorological variables at any user-defined sampling rate. The number of DAMs operating in an ECT could be increased by connecting multiple DAMs to the same data bus implementing the RS-485 standard. A signal-conditioning module was also designed to homogenize the output of the bio-meteorological sensors (Castro et al. 2017).
